Looks like a future F/W release 2.04.00 covers the hum problem. Release notes showed 11MAY2012 on MOL..
Resolved issues in R02.04.00 product release
Resolved issues are the known product problems that were reported in products releases, but have now been fixed or closed.
Issue Number
Product / Version Found
Impact Description CCMPD01635369 2.00.00 Humming sound on analog channels of MOTOTRBO 2.0 mobiles
CCMPD01576056
2.00.00
When the Channel Dial Feature is enabled and the Channel is changed from the Home screen, the radio will power up on the previously used channel rather than the Channel set from Home screen after the next Radio Power cycle. CCMPD01582326 2.00.00 The Mobile Numeric Display Radio LED used to indicate Channel Change mode may blink at a faster than usual rate when a Call is received concurrently with a Channel Mode change. When radio user presses the dual Volume/Channel knob on the Numeric Mobile to change the channel, the 7 Segment LED will blink to indicate that the radio is in Channel Change mode. If then at the same time the radio receives a call, the blinking rate of the 7 Segment LED will become faster. After the 10 second channel change mode timer times out or the call ends, the 7 Segment LED will return to the normal blinking rate.
